First Impressions

The Tapo P110 smart plugs arrive in a compact, easy-to-handle package that facilitates simple installation. The design is minimalistic, avoiding interference with adjacent sockets, which is a significant advantage in crowded power strips. The setup process is straightforward, requiring no additional hubs, allowing users to get started quickly through the Tapo app.

Key Features in Detail

1.

Remote Control: Users can manage connected devices from anywhere via the Tapo app, which is crucial for energy monitoring and conservation. This feature allows for real-time management of energy consumption, which is vital given the rising electricity prices in the UK.

2.

Scheduling: The ability to set schedules for devices can lead to substantial energy savings. For instance, homeowners can program their plugs to turn on lights or appliances only when needed, reducing electricity bills significantly.

3.

Energy Monitoring: One of the standout features is the energy usage monitoring capability, which helps users track their power consumption. This feature can lead to better energy management decisions, particularly as UK electricity prices hover around £0.34 per kWh.

4.

Voice Control: The Tapo P110 is compatible with both Amazon Alexa and Google Assistant, allowing for hands-free control. This integration is ideal for those who prefer a smart home environment or have mobility issues.

5.

Away Mode: This feature simulates your presence at home by turning devices on and off randomly, enhancing home security.

Build Quality

The compact design of the Tapo P110 is a testament to thoughtful engineering, allowing it to fit alongside other plugs without blocking adjacent outlets. The build quality is robust, and the materials used feel durable, indicating a product designed for longevity.
